What is “Feather LiftTM?”
The "FeatherLiftTM" is a non-surgical approach to facial skin lifting utilizing the patented "Aptos® threads."



What are “Aptos® Threads?”
The "Aptos® threads" are made of a synthetic suture material called "polypropylene." Aptos® threads are designed with tiny, barb-like bidirectional cogs. Once inserted under the skin, the cogs of the Aptos® threads open in an umbrella-like fashion and form a support structure for the tissue of the face supporting lax and sagging soft tissue.



Who is a candidate for the FeatherLiftTM?
The best candidates are men and women 30 to 60 years of age who have:

  • A drop of the soft tissues of the face and neck.
  • Weakly pronounced aesthetic contours.
  • A flaccid, flat face.
  • Premature aging and sun damaged face.


Is it hard to perform?
Performed under local anesthesia with the patient remaining awake and alert, this procedure is quick and easy. The Aptos® threads are inserted with a special hollow needle under the skin at a required depth, along contours that were previously accentuated on the face.



How does the “Feather LiftTM” differ from a conventional face lift?
This safe procedure takes approximately 30 to 90 minutes to perform, depending on the number of areas being treated. The FeatherLiftTM does not leave any scars, requires no bandages and has minimal down time. Aftercare usually involves ice packs to the treated area, minimal facial movements and gentle tissue manipulation.
